Default Size: Terra Crusher vs Monster GT

Looks like the Monster GT didn't top the Terra Crusher in size, but it does tell me how big the GT is and DAM! thats another huge 1/8th scale on the market.

Monster GT:
• Overall Length: 22 in bumper to bumper
• Width: 17.25 in
• Height: 10.75 in to top of cab
• Wheelbase: 14.5 in
• Weight (RTR): 12 pounds

Terra Crusher:
• Length 22 inches
• width 17-1/3 inches
• height 11-1/4 inches
• wheel base 14-1/6 inches
• fully equipped weight of about 12-1/2 pounds

jus interesting facts I thought I'd point out. I'd throw the Dirt Demon in to the mix, but I can't locate size stats about it.

Default Size: Terra Crusher vs Monster GT

DIRT DEMON SPECS Straight frome TowerHobbies

SPECS: Vehicle-
Length: 19.5" (495mm)
Width: 18.1" (457mm)
Height: 8.0" (203mm)
Wheelbase: 13" (330mm) (wheels on-center front-to-rear)
Tread- Front- 16" Rear- 16" (wheels on-center side-to-side)
Ground Clearance: 3.7" (93mm)
Gear Ratio: 4.33:1
Tires- Front: 4" x 7.0" (101x177mm)
Rear: 4" x 7.0" (101x177mm)
Body-
Length: 18-1/8" (460mm)
Width: 6-3/4" (171mm) at rear wheels (widest point)
Height: 5-1/4" (133mm)
